Christian deVirgilio is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Surgery and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Christian deVirgilio has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 321 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 12 papers in Surgery and 7 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Christian deVirgilio’s work include Vascular Procedures and Complications (10 papers),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(10 papers) and Aortic Disease and Treatment Approaches (6 papers). Christian deVirgilio is often cited by papers focused on Vascular Procedures and Complications (10 papers),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(10 papers) and Aortic Disease and Treatment Approaches (6 papers). Christian deVirgilio collaborates with scholars based in United States and United Kingdom. Christian deVirgilio's co-authors include George E. Kopchok, Irwin Walot, Rodney A. White, Eric P. Wilson, Carlos E. Donayre, Dennis Y. Kim, David Plurad, C M Mehringer, Matthew C. Koopmann and R. A. White and has published in prestigious journals such as Annals of Surgery, Journal of Vascular Surgery and World Journal of Surgery.
